Woody Harrelson is an American actor and playwright. He first became known for his role as bartender Woody Boyd on the NBC sitcom Cheers (1985–1993), for which he won a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Supporting Actor in a Comedy Series from a total of five nominations. One of the bes...Dec 9, 2022 · Woody Harrelson replaced Nicholas Colasanto on the television series “Cheers.” Nicholas Colasanto played the character Coach on the show but sadly passed away during the third season. Following Colasanto’s death, Woody Harrelson joined the cast in the fourth season as a new character named Woody Boyd.
